What : Maybank Treats Fair 2009
When : 23rd - 26th July 2009
Where : Mid Valley Exhibition Centre
Who : Open to Public

Maybank Treats Fair started on 2005 and it's back for the 7th time. Treats Fair is open to general public, anyone can visit. However, for Maybankard Credit Card holders, you can redeem goods with your TreatsPoints. Also, there'll be lots of offers, bargains and Guranteed Gifts. Not to mention up to 36 months 0% EzyPay program on offer.

Key highlights (2008):
60 Minutes Card - Approval of new card application within 60 minutes.


for those who havent got their Maybank CC, it's the time to apply there...

60minutes approval, u will get a temporary CC to be use in the compound (fair) only.

Actual Card will be available after 1 week at your selected bank for collection.!

Dear Mr. Puvan,

Thank you for your email.

We are pleased to inform you that the permanent privilege is valid for all Direct Access MasterCard.

You will enjoy an exclusive 2% rebate* for all transactions at any petrol station nationwide with Direct Access MasterCard! (*Rebate is subject to a maximum spending of RM2,500 at all petrol stations or rebate of RM50 per card per month).

The cash rebate will be credited into your card once a month.
